Opting for Solenoid Valves for Tandoor Burners
When picking solenoid valves for your tandoor burner, it's crucial to consider several factors. The capacity of the valve should be compatible with the needs of your burner. You'll also need to determine the power need for the valve, ensuring it aligns with the voltage of your electrical system.
Furthermore, factors like maximum pressure and build should be meticulously evaluated. A valve made of stainless steel will be more long-lasting against the temperature generated by the burner.

Troubleshooting Common Issues with Gas Meters and Ball Valves
Gas meters and ball valves serve crucial roles in your home's gas system, ensuring proper delivery and control of fuel. However, occasionally these components can develop issues that demand attention. A malfunctioning gas meter may show inaccurate readings, leading to billing discrepancies. Similarly, a stuck or damaged ball valve can stop gas flow partially, posing a concern.
- Common issues with gas meters include fluctuations in readings, buzzing sounds, and visible damage. Ball valves may become jammed, weep gas, or stop to shut properly.
- Pinpointing the source of these issues is crucial for safe and successful repair.
Periodic inspections by a qualified gas technician can help prevent major problems and guarantee the safe functioning of your gas system.
